Source: SBA 7(a) FOIA loan-level data, aggregated by FranchiseVerdict
Charge-off rate = charge-offs / (charge-offs + paid-in-full). Active, exempt, and cancelled loans are excluded. Risk ratings: Excellent (<5%), Good (5-10%), Average (10-15%), Elevated (15-20%), High Risk (>20%).

- What is the charge-off rate and why does it matter?
- Charge-off rate = charge-offs / (charge-offs + paid-in-full). For SBA 7(a) franchise lending, the national average runs 5–8%. Portfolios materially above that signal either riskier franchise selection or weaker underwriting.
- Where does this lending data come from?
- SBA 7(a) loan records released under the Freedom of Information Act. Each record carries approval date, amount, lender, business type, NAICS code, location, and outcome. See methodology.
